Timimoun vs Wiluna, Western Australia Climate & Distance Between

Australia flag
  • The distance between Timimoun, Algeria and Wiluna, Western Australia, Australia is approximately 14,176 km or 8,809 mi.
  • To reach Timimoun in this distance one would set out from Wiluna, Western Australia bearing 287.7°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Timimoun bearing 282.6° or WNW .
  • Both have a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Timimoun is in or near the subtropical desert biome whereas Wiluna, Western Australia is in or near the subtropical desert scrub bi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 1.9 °C (3.4°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 5.2 °C (9.4°F) more in Timimoun.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 218 mm (8.6 in) less which is equivalent to 218 l/m² (5.35 US gal/ft²) or 2,180,000 l/ha (233,056 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 1.9° lower in Timimoun than in Wiluna, Western Australia.
